Transponder Codes

When a transponder gets interrogated it sends out an encoded signal with an eight-digit code. This signal is called a SQUAWK code and forms the basis for aircraft identification on radar screens. It is also used to relay a specific message to the air traffic control system in the event of an emergency or to alert controllers of changing weather conditions. Squawk codes are frequently utilized to communicate with ATC in situations where the pilot cannot talk on the radio and are crucial for safe flying.

Each aircraft is equipped with a transponder that responds to radar queries by displaying an identifier. This enables ATC to locate the aircraft in a busy radar screen. Transponders can be configured to respond in various ways when questioned. Mode A transmits only the code, whereas mode C also provides altitude information. Mode S transponders give more details like call signs and location that can be helpful in airspace that is congested.

The transponder may be set to the 'ON', the ALT, or the SBY (standby position) positions.

Air traffic control will typically instruct a pilot to "squawk the ident". This is an instruction for pilots to press their transponder IDENT button. The ident button causes the aircraft blink on ATC radar screens, allowing them to easily identify your aircraft on the screen.

PIN codes

A PIN code is a series of numbers (usually 4 or 6 digits) that are used to gain access to a device, service, or system. For instance, a smart phone, for instance, has PIN codes that the user must enter each time they use the device. PIN codes are used to secure ATM and POS transactions[1Secure access control (doors computers, cars),[2] and internet transactions.

Even though a longer PIN may appear to be more secure than a shorter one, it's still possible to hack or guess a four-digit PIN. It is recommended that the PIN be at least six digits long using a mix of letters and numbers to give more security. VIN Numbers

VIN numbers can be used to identify cars and provide a wealth of information about them. VIN numbers are unique for every vehicle on earth and are not applicable to alien vehicles (or whatever). The 17 digits of a VIN code are a combination letters and numbers which can be decoded to reveal crucial information about your vehicle or truck.

Modern automobiles contain a tremendous amount of information about their history and features they act as mobile digital libraries. The key to accessing this information is the VIN number. This allows you to discover everything from if your car was involved in a recall, to how many owners it's had.

Each section of a VIN number consists of a distinct piece of information. The first digit identifies for instance, what type of car it is, such an automobile for passengers, a pickup truck or SUV. The second number is the manufacturer. The third digit indicates the division of assembly for the car.
